Now Hiring for an Manufacturing Process Engineer III (Industrial Engineer) at our Jacksonville, NC manufacturing plant. In this role you will be counted on and responsible for developing and optimizing manufacturing processes that ensure safety, efficiency, and scalability. This role maintains master data accuracy for relevant manufacturing engineering processes, supports new product introductions, and validates processes to meet quality, cost, and delivery targets.

By collaborating with cross-functional teams, the engineer drives continuous improvement initiatives, implements Lean principles, and leverages digital tools to enhance performance.

Process Design:
  • Design and optimize manufacturing processes, including but not limited to process sequence flow, line balancing, capacity planning, and production layouts, ensuring efficient, safe, and scalable operations.
  • Lead and participate in process risk assessments, including PFMEA and ergonomics evaluations, to proactively address and mitigate safety, quality, and operational risks.
  • Collaborate with engineering, production, and finance teams to justify CAPEX investments and select appropriate machinery for the manufacturing process.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ams (operations, facilities, finance) to scope, justify, and implement capital projects. Participate in long term capital investment planning to align with business growth, operations strategy and capacity planning.
  • Utilize simulation tools to validate process flows, resource requirements, and production efficiency.
  • Support the overall plant layout design strategy to ensure efficient material flow, scalability and production.
Process Implementation:
  • Develop and implement standard operating procedures (SOPs), work instructions, and visual work aids to standardize processes and improve consistency.
  • Prepare work cells and production areas for new product introductions or process changes, ensuring readiness and minimal disruption to production.
  • Provide Train- the
    -trainer sessions to front line leaders on new processes, tools, and workflows. Partner with safety teams to ensures processes meets safety standards.
  • Own the end-to-end lifecycle of capital equipment projects, from initial concept and design through procurement, installation, and commissioning. Including but not limited to TPM, business continuity for equipment, spare parts, and any service agreements or training needed to support the equipment.
Process Validation:
  • Conduct process validation studies including time studies, measurement system analysis and capability assessments.
  • Attain key performance indicators (KPIs) such as OEE, FPY, and CPK to confirm process capability and identify areas for improvement.
  • Partner with quality teams to ensure processes meet internal standards, regulatory requirements, and customer expectations.
Design for Manufacturability (DFM):
  • Owning manufacturing requirements for product design.
  • Collaborate with R&D teams early in the development cycle to integrate DFM principles, ensuring products are cost-effective, scalable, and manufacturable.
  • Provide feedback on design feasibility, tooling requirements, and process constraints to minimize downstream production issues.
  • Partner with Advanced Manufacturing and OT to review design for automation opportunities.
Continuous Improvement / Lean Manufacturing:
  • Lead and participate in continuous improvement initiatives using Lean tools such as value stream mapping (VSM), kaizen, and standard work development.
  • Collect and evaluate data to identify opportunities for process improvement. Use problem-solving methodologies and analysis (DoE, SPC, 5 Whys, A3, Fishbone) to identify the root cause implement the corrective actions/improvements.
  • Identify and eliminate waste in processes while embedding sustainability and energy efficiency principles.
